Warehouse Assistant
Chandlers Ford
Reports to: Warehouse Supervisor
Full time, Monday to Thursday 8:30 – 17:00 Friday 8:30 – 4:30
£24,000 - £25,000

Attega Group is recruiting on behalf of our client who is a UK-based leader in infection control solutions and decontamination equipment serving healthcare, laboratory, and life science industries.

Purpose of the Role:

  • To support the daily warehouse operations including receiving, storing, picking, packing, and dispatching goods.

Key Responsibilities

  • Assist in receiving, checking, and storing incoming stock.
  • Reporting any errors and / or faulty parts.
  • Pick and pack orders accurately for delivery or collection.
  • Maintain inventory records and conduct regular stock counts.
  • Load and unload goods using manual handling equipment or forklifts (if certified).
  • Keep warehouse areas clean, organised, and safe at all times.
  • Assist in the preparation of shipments and documentation.
  • Follow company policies, health and safety regulations, and warehouse procedures.
  • Report damaged or missing inventory to supervisors.
  • Collaborate with team members and support other departments as needed.
  • General housekeeping duties.
  • Handling of returns and quarantines within the warehouse with close communication with other departments to ensure the efficient handling of such items.
  • Any other duties required to support the business.

 Skills & Requirements

  • Previous experience in a warehouse or similar environment is desirable but not essential.
  • Good attention to detail ensuring quality and minimising errors.
  • A flexible approach with the ability to follow detailed instructions.
  • Knowledge of manufacturing production and processes.
  • This role requires physical stamina and the ability to work efficiently in a fast-paced environment.
  • Basic math’s and computer skills.
  • Good communication and teamwork skills.
  • Forklift certification is a plus.

What We Offer

  • On-site parking
  • 25 days holiday, plus bank holidays
  • Social events and work parties
